FREEDOM FOR COMRADE MILOŠ KARAVEZIĆ!
The First Secretary of the League of the Communist Youth of Yugoslavia SKOJ (the youth organisation of the New Communist Party of Yugoslavia), comrade Miloš Karavezić, was arrested near Istanbul at approximately 3.00am on 1 July during an internal anti-Nato conference.
Erdogan's authorities raided the camp of the World Anti-Imperialist Platform, where youth organisations were gathered. At around 8.00am, they violently and unlawfully detained approximately twenty people, including members of the international delegation and Turkish youth activists, among them the First Secretary of SKOJ, Comrade Miloš Karavezić.
All those detained are currently being held at the police station in Çanakkale, where they face accusations of alleged terrorist activities.
This is part of an organised campaign of preventive arrests carried out under the pretext of protecting national security.
From midnight on 28 June until midnight on 10 July, all public gatherings, demonstrations, street marches, press conferences, leaflet distribution and the display of banners have been banned in Ankara and in the areas surrounding Nato military bases. The main access routes to the airport, the area surrounding the summit venue, and the zones where the delegations are accommodated have been placed under the complete control of the military and police.
The actions of the Turkish authorities are contrary to the Constitution of the Republic of Türkiye, which guarantees freedom of thought and academic freedom. They are likewise in violation of the International Covenant on Civil and Political Rights, ratified by Türkiye in 2003, which guarantees freedom of thought and freedom of expression.
